Output e8b935fe678b01cdd4fcc3e82c7a21ce1088a004bcd113207d86f9980c261186:5

value
666973
script pubkey
OP_0 OP_PUSHBYTES_20 3e37c4ebcfccc580ff0c6dcef5388d4934730d52
address
bc1q8cmuf670enzcplcvdh802wydfy68xr2j2vwdgz
transaction
e8b935fe678b01cdd4fcc3e82c7a21ce1088a004bcd113207d86f9980c261186
spent
true